Israel Intercepts Freedom Flotilla Aid Ship, Detains 21 Activists

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The Israeli military forces raided the Handala ship en route to Gaza on Saturday, July 27, 2025. The attack took place in international waters, approximately 40 nautical miles from the coast of Gaza. The ship is part of the Freedom Flotilla Coalition humanitarian mission that aims to break the Israeli blockade of Gaza.

According to Anadolu, on Friday morning, the Freedom Flotilla Coalition announced that Handala was continuing its mission and was less than 349 nautical miles or approximately 646 kilometers away from Gaza. However, contact with the ship was lost for two hours, during which a drone was seen around the ship. "For about two hours, our Freedom Flotilla boat’s communications were interrupted, and drones were observed near the boat, raising serious concerns of a potential attack," the coalition wrote on Telegram.

According to the official statement of the Freedom Flotilla Coalition, the raid occurred at 23:43 Palestinian time. At that time, the ship's cameras were forcibly shut off, and all communication was severed. "The Occupation cut the cameras on board Handala, and we have lost all communication with our ship," they wrote.

The Handala ship carried urgent aid for the people of Gaza, including baby formula, diapers, food, and medicine. All the cargo was civilian and contained no military elements. The Freedom Flotilla stated that the raid violated international maritime law as it took place outside Palestinian territorial waters.

21 Activists from 12 Countries

A total of 21 activists were on board the Handala ship, representing 12 countries and comprising human rights activists, journalists, lawyers, parliamentarians, workers, and scientists. Some of them include: Christian Smalls (US), Huwaida Arraf (Palestine/US), Emma Fourreau (France/Sweden), Gabrielle Cathala (France), Antonio Mazzeo (Italy), Santiago Gonzlez Vallejo (Spain), Robert Martin (Australia), and Mohamed El Bakkali (Morocco), a senior Al Jazeera journalist.

According to the Freedom Flotilla, before the raid occurred, the ship's crew had declared that they would go on a hunger strike if detained and would not accept food from Israeli forces.

Third Attack in One Year

The raid on Handala marks the third attack on the Freedom Flotilla aid ships this year. On May 2, the MV Conscience was attacked by a drone in international waters near Malta, causing a fire and injuring four people.

On June 9, Israel seized the Madleen ship off the coast of Gaza and arrested 12 international activists, including Swedish activist Greta Thunberg and European Parliament member Rima Hassan. They were later deported with the condition of not returning to Gaza.

The Freedom Flotilla Coalition criticized Israel for disregarding the binding orders of the International Court of Justice (ICJ) to facilitate humanitarian access to Gaza. "Israel has no legal authority to detain international civilians aboard the Handala," said Ann Wright, a member of the Freedom Flotilla steering committee.

She also stated that this case is not within the internal jurisdiction of Israel because the passengers are foreign nationals operating under international law in international waters, so their detention is considered arbitrary, violates the law, and must be stopped immediately.
